  • National Archives rebuffs Dems request for Kavanaugh documents

    08/03/2018 10:31:39 AM PDT · by jazusamo · 40 replies
    The Hill ^ | August 3, 2018 | Jordain Carney
    The Democratic push to get documents from Supreme Court nominee Brett Kavanaugh's work in the George W. Bush administration ran into a new roadblock on Friday. The National Archives, in a letter to Senate Minority Leader Charles Schumer (D-N.Y.), said it will only respond to a request for documents under the Presidential Records Act (PRA) if they come from a committee chairman, who are all Republicans. The National Archives and Records “remains unable to respond to PRA special access requests from ranking minority members,” wrote Archivist David Ferriero, who was appointed by former President Obama.   • Vehicle Suspected of being Stolen by Man Wanted By FBI found in Nitro, WV

    08/03/2018 9:11:28 AM PDT · by Morgana · 21 replies
    WOWK TV NEWS 13 ^ | August 3, 2018 | WOWK
    NITRO, WV (WOWK) - A vehicle believed to have been stolen by a man wanted by the FBI for making threats against President Donald Trump and law enforcement was found in the Nitro area. He is believed to be armed and dangerous. According to the FBI a vehicle Shawn Christy, 26, of McAdoo, Pennsylvania, is suspected of stealing from Butler Township, PA on July 29th, 2018 was located on August 2nd, 2018 in the Nitro area.
